Introduction
AI-Powered DevSecOps: In the ever-evolving landscape of technology, two titanic forces have been converging to redefine the way we build, deploy, and secure software applications. On one side stands the game-changing power of Artificial Intelligence (AI), and on the other, the revolutionary philosophy of DevSecOps. As these forces converge, a new era of software development is emerging – one that promises unparalleled efficiency, speed, and security. In this blog, we will explore how the fusion of AI and DevSecOps is reshaping the future of software development, creating a synergy that propels us towards a more secure and innovative digital world.
Table of Contents
The DevSecOps Evolution
DevSecOps has helped in faster Software Development built in quality and security as part of software development lifecycle. It advocates for the integration of security practices right from the beginning of the development process, rather than as an afterthought. Traditionally, security has been bolted onto software at the end, resulting in vulnerabilities and costly delays. DevSecOps unites development and security teams, fostering collaboration and continuous improvement.
AI’s Prowess in DevSecOps
Artificial Intelligence, the pinnacle of human technological achievement, has been steadily gaining ground across industries. Its analytical prowess, combined with machine learning, is reshaping the way we approach security and operations. One prime example of AI in DevSecOps is its ability to analyse vast datasets to identify potential security threats and vulnerabilities. For instance, AI-driven code analysis tools can sift through lines of code, spotting patterns and anomalies that could indicate security risks.
Automating the Secure Pipeline
Imagine an AI-driven pipeline that autonomously reviews code, detects vulnerabilities, and suggests remediation steps – all in real-time. This is no longer science fiction. AI-driven tools can scan code for potential security flaws, ensuring adherence to security protocols. Additionally, AI can intelligently allocate resources, optimize deployment, and even predict potential issues, thus transforming DevSecOps into a well-oiled machine.
Case in Point: Firm ABC
Firm ABC, the streaming giant, has always been a trailblazer in technology. The company employs AI-powered DevSecOps to maintain its agile and secure infrastructure. By integrating AI-driven analytics into its development pipeline, Firm ABC can identify potential security weaknesses early in the process. This proactive approach not only boosts the security posture of their applications but also accelerates their time-to-market.
Predictive Security Analytics
AI’s predictive capabilities are a game-changer in the realm of security. By analysing historical data, AI algorithms can predict potential threats and vulnerabilities, allowing DevSecOps teams to take pre-emptive action. For instance, AI can foresee patterns of attack and provide insights into the best mitigation strategies. This proactive approach ensures that security measures evolve ahead of potential threats.
AI-Powered DevSecOps: Challenges on the Horizon
While the marriage of AI and DevSecOps brings numerous benefits, it’s not without challenges. Integrating AI requires substantial investment in infrastructure, training, and data management. Additionally, there are ethical concerns regarding the use of AI in security. Striking the right balance between automation and human oversight is critical to prevent AI from becoming a double-edged sword.
AI-Powered DevSecOps :Conclusion: The Future Unveiled
The fusion of Artificial Intelligence and DevSecOps is not just a technological novelty; it’s a future imperative. As software development becomes increasingly complex and security threats more sophisticated, this alliance offers a beacon of hope. Through predictive analytics, automated security measures, and proactive threat detection, AI-powered DevSecOps is transforming the landscape. The likes of Firm ABC are already reaping the rewards of this union, demonstrating that efficiency and security can indeed coexist.
The journey towards a future where AI-powered DevSecOps reigns supreme might be challenging, but the destination is undoubtedly worth the effort. The era of bolted-on security and delayed deployments is coming to an end, making way for a new dawn of secure, efficient, and innovative software development. Embracing this paradigm shift is not just an option; it’s the key to staying ahead in an ever-competitive digital realm.
Scrum Guide for Roles in Agile Way of Working for Product Owner